Change all refs to use "throw null;" as member bodies
Following our new guidelines for ref assembly implementations and what GenApi now creates, this updates all of our ref .cs files to use "throw null;" for member bodies that can't just be empty (i.e. members that need to return a value either via the return type or via an out parameter). I made the change programatically using a simple Roslyn-based tool.
